The goal this winter for AC Milan is to sign a centre-back in order to replace Simon Kjaer who is absent due to injury. Many profiles are linked with a move to the Rossoneri as the management searches for the right player who can be brought to Milanello on a loan with option to buy.
There are several names highlighted in red for Paolo Maldini and Frederic Massara. The most expensive one is Sven Botman who is 21 years old. He costs 30 million euros and Lille have no intention of accepting a loan with a buy-option.
The second profile is Jhon Lucumi, central defender of Genk, 23, and is valued at 25 million euros. Then, there is Attila Szalai of Fenerbahce, the Turkish club asks for at least 20 million. The Hungarian defender is also liked by Napoli.
Former Dortmund player, and currently at PSG, Abdou Diallo, is worth 25 million euros. However, if Leonardo opens up to a loan with obligation to buy if certain conditions are met, then a deal may happen between the AC Milan managers and the French outfit.
